Tue Nov 05 01:10:00 UTC 2024: ## Chhath Puja Begins Today: Millions Celebrate the Festival of Sun God
**New Delhi, India:** The annual Chhath Puja festival, a sacred and ancient celebration dedicated to the Sun God and Chhathi Maiya, commenced today, November 5th, with the first day, “Nहाय खाय.”
Chhath Puja, particularly significant in Bihar, Jharkhand, eastern Uttar Pradesh, and parts of Nepal, is a four-day long festival where devotees observe strict fasting and offer prayers to the Sun God for prosperity, good health, and happiness.
The festival, which will continue until November 8th, is marked by a series of rituals culminating in offering prayers to the setting and rising sun. Devotees observe stringent rules, including fasting and maintaining purity.
The Chhath Puja festivities include “Nहाय खाय” (bathing and consuming a simple meal), “खरना” (a special meal with sweet potatoes and kheer), “Sandhya Arghya” (offering prayers to the setting sun), and “Prat:hkalin Arghya” (offering prayers to the rising sun).
People gather at the banks of holy rivers like the Ganges and Yamuna, or lakes, to offer their prayers to the Sun God.
